Bombay Super Hybrid Seeds Limited (BSHSL.NS) closed at ₹95.8 on the NSE, marking a decline of 1.77% in the latest session. The stock is currently trading near its identified support level of ₹91.01, with resistance at ₹100.59. The move reflects cautious sentiment in the agri-seed sector amid broader market headwinds.

In the recent trading session, Bombay Super Hybrid Seeds witnessed a price decline of 1.77%, settling at ₹95.8 on the NSE. The stock’s volume patterns appeared elevated relative to its recent average, suggesting heightened participation from both retail and institutional players. This selling pressure comes despite the company’s position in the growing hybrid seeds segment, which benefits from government focus on agricultural productivity and rising demand for high-yield crop varieties. Sectorally, the agri-input space has seen mixed performance, with some peers reporting steady demand while others face margin pressures due to rising input costs. BSHSL’s move lower may reflect profit booking after a recent uptrend, as the stock had previously rallied from lower levels. The key driver behind the current weakness appears to be short-term profit-taking, combined with a cautious stance from traders ahead of the upcoming sowing season data. The stock remains within a defined range, with the ₹91.01 support serving as a critical floor. A sustained break below this level could accelerate selling, while holding above it may attract bargain hunters.

From a technical perspective, BSHSL is testing the lower band of its recent consolidation zone. The price action shows the stock forming lower highs in the short term, with the Relative Strength Index (RSI) likely in the mid-40s range, indicating waning momentum but not yet oversold territory. The moving average convergence divergence (MACD) has been showing a bearish crossover in recent sessions, suggesting near-term weakness. The stock’s immediate support stands at ₹91.01, a level that coincides with earlier swing lows from the past few weeks. If this support holds, the price could attempt a recovery toward the resistance zone at ₹100.59. On the upside, a breakout above ₹100.59 would confirm a bullish reversal and potentially open the path toward higher levels. The 50-day exponential moving average (EMA) is likely positioned around the ₹93-₹95 range, adding a layer of dynamic support near current prices. Volume analysis indicates that the decline was accompanied by above-average turnover, which often signals strong conviction behind the move. Traders may watch for a volume contraction on a bounce, which would suggest the selling pressure is exhausting.

Looking ahead, Bombay Super Hybrid Seeds’ price trajectory could be influenced by several factors. If the stock manages to hold above the ₹91.01 support level, a bounce toward the ₹98-₹100 area may occur over the next few sessions. However, a decisive close below ₹91.01 could push the stock toward the next support zone around ₹86-₹88, where previous price consolidation occurred. Fundamental catalysts to monitor include the company’s quarterly earnings release, any updates on new hybrid seed product approvals, and broader monsoon forecasts that impact the agricultural sector. Additionally, any positive commentary from the management regarding order book visibility or margin expansion could reignite buying interest. Conversely, adverse weather conditions or policy changes affecting seed pricing may weigh on sentiment. Investors should watch for the stock’s ability to reclaim the ₹100.59 resistance level, as a sustained move above it would signal renewed strength. Until clearer directional cues emerge, the stock may remain range-bound, with high sensitivity to broader market trends and sector-specific news flow.
